What Is an Airport Transfer?

An airport transfer is a pre-arranged ride between an airport and your final destination. Unlike hailing a cab at the curb or requesting an Uber after you land, an airport transfer is booked in advance. The price is set before you travel, the vehicle is confirmed, and your driver knows exactly when and where to meet you.

Here's what that means in practice. You land at JFK. Your phone buzzes with a text from your driver confirming they're in position. You walk out of baggage claim, and a professional chauffeur is waiting with your name, ready to load your bags and start the drive east. No scrambling for a cab line. No watching an Uber driver circle the terminal three times. No surge pricing surprise on your phone screen.

The term "transfer" simply means getting you from point A (the airport) to point B (your home, hotel, rental house, or wherever you're headed). It's the opposite of winging it.

Types of Airport Transfers

Not all airport transfers are the same. Here's what's available and how each option stacks up for Hamptons travel specifically.

Shared Shuttle

A van or bus that picks up multiple parties and drops them off at different locations along the route. You share the vehicle with strangers and make multiple stops. For a 2-hour trip to the Hamptons, this can add an hour or more to your travel time. Shared shuttles are the cheapest option, but they're slow and unpredictable for East End destinations.

Private Car Service

A vehicle booked exclusively for your party. No other stops, no other passengers. This is the standard for Hamptons airport transfers because the distance makes shared rides impractical. You choose your vehicle type (sedan, SUV, Sprinter van), and the car goes directly from the airport to your door.

Premium Limo Service

Same concept as private car service, but with higher-end vehicles, additional amenities, and professional chauffeurs with local expertise. For the Hamptons, this typically means a Chevrolet Suburban (seats 6), Mercedes S-Class (seats 3), or a Mercedes Sprinter van (seats up to 14) for larger groups. After a long flight and a 2-hour drive, the comfort difference is real.

Taxi or Ride-Share

Technically an option, but not a true "transfer" in the pre-booked sense. Taxis and ride-shares like Uber and Lyft are on-demand, with variable pricing. For short city trips, they work fine. For a 2.5-hour ride from JFK to the Hamptons, the downsides multiply: surge pricing on Friday afternoons, driver cancellations on long trips, and no flight tracking if you're delayed.

Train and Bus

The LIRR runs to Hamptons stations from Penn Station, and there are bus services from Manhattan. But neither connects directly to JFK, LaGuardia, or Newark. You'd need to get from the airport to Manhattan first (via AirTrain, taxi, or subway), then transfer to the LIRR or bus. Total time: 3 to 4+ hours with multiple connections. It works on a budget, but it's not convenient after a long flight.

Why Pre-Booked Transfers Beat On-Demand for the Hamptons

For a quick ride across Manhattan, Uber works fine. For a 2-hour trip from JFK to East Hampton on a Friday evening in July? Pre-booked is the only way to go. Here's why.

  • Price is locked in. Ride-share pricing fluctuates with demand. On summer Friday afternoons at JFK, surge multipliers can push fares well above normal rates. With a pre-booked transfer, your price doesn't change regardless of demand.
  • No cancellations. Uber and Lyft drivers frequently cancel long-distance trips to the Hamptons. They don't want to drive 2+ hours east and then deadhead back to the city. With a dedicated car service, your vehicle is committed to your trip.
  • Flight tracking is standard. Your driver monitors your flight in real time. Land an hour late? The car is still there, adjusted automatically. With ride-share, you're rebooking from the terminal at whatever the current price happens to be.
  • You know what you're getting. Book a Suburban, get a Suburban. Book an S-Class, get an S-Class. Ride-share vehicle quality varies, and you won't know until the car pulls up.
  • Drivers who know the route. Our chauffeurs have driven JFK to Southampton thousands of times. They know when to take the Southern State, when to cut through back roads in Westhampton, and when the LIE is a parking lot. That local knowledge can save 30 minutes on a bad traffic day.

What Affects the Cost of an Airport Transfer?

Every airport transfer is quoted based on a few straightforward factors. There are no hidden fees, and the price you're quoted is the price you pay.

  • Distance: JFK to Southampton is shorter than JFK to Montauk. MacArthur to the Hamptons is the shortest of all. The distance drives the base rate.
  • Vehicle type: A Mercedes S-Class sedan for two passengers costs less than a Chevrolet Suburban for a family of six. Sprinter vans for larger groups are priced accordingly.
  • Airport: Newark transfers cost more than JFK or LaGuardia because of the additional distance and tunnel tolls.
  • Tolls: Bridge and tunnel tolls are included or itemized depending on the route. We're upfront about this at booking.
  • Extra stops: Need to pick up a second party at a different terminal, or stop in Manhattan on the way? Additional stops can be added for a small fee.

Airports We Serve for Hamptons Transfers

We run airport transfers from all four major airports in the New York metro area to every Hamptons destination.

AirportCodeDrive to HamptonsBest For
MacArthurISP45 min to 1 hrShortest drive, limited flights
JFKJFK2 to 2.5 hrsInternational, most flight options
LaGuardiaLGA2 to 2.5 hrsDomestic flights, less hectic
NewarkEWR2.5 to 3 hrsUnited Airlines hub

Tips for Booking Your Airport Transfer

  • Book 24 to 48 hours ahead when possible, especially during summer weekends. Peak season fills up fast. Last-minute requests are possible, but advance booking guarantees vehicle availability.
  • Share your full flight details. Airline, flight number, and scheduled arrival time. This lets us track your flight and adjust if you're delayed.
  • Give us the exact destination address. "Southampton" could mean the village center, a beachfront house, or a hotel on the highway. The address determines accurate pricing and timing.
  • Let us know about luggage and group size. Family of five with surfboards and a dog crate? We'll send the right vehicle. Traveling solo with a carry-on? A sedan is perfect.
  • Consider timing. If you have flexibility, avoiding Friday 3pm to 7pm arrivals during summer can save significant drive time due to Hamptons-bound traffic on the LIE and Route 27.
